The Foundation of Intimate Bliss: Emotional Intimacy

At the heart of any profound relationship lies emotional intimacy, a cornerstone that forms the basis for deeper connections. It involves sharing vulnerabilities, expressing authentic emotions, and fostering an environment of trust and acceptance. By prioritizing emotional intimacy, individuals can create a safe space where they feel comfortable expressing their true selves, leading to a stronger bond and a more fulfilling romantic partnership. According to renowned therapist Dr. Emma Johnson, “Emotional intimacy is the glue that holds relationships together, allowing partners to navigate challenges and celebrate triumphs as a united front.”

Building emotional intimacy requires active effort and a willingness to be vulnerable. It involves engaging in open and honest conversations, sharing personal thoughts and feelings, and actively listening to one another. This process allows couples to develop a deeper understanding of each other's needs, desires, and emotions, fostering a sense of empathy and connection. As Dr. Johnson emphasizes, "When partners prioritize emotional intimacy, they create a foundation of trust and respect, which is essential for a healthy and satisfying relationship."

To cultivate emotional intimacy, couples can implement various practices. Regularly scheduling dedicated time for deep conversations, creating a judgment-free zone, and actively practicing empathy are powerful tools. Additionally, engaging in activities that promote emotional connection, such as sharing personal stories, expressing gratitude, and engaging in couple's therapy or counseling, can further strengthen the emotional bond.

Overcoming Barriers to Emotional Intimacy

While emotional intimacy is essential, it is not without its challenges. Barriers such as fear of vulnerability, past traumas, or communication breakdowns can hinder its development. However, with awareness and commitment, these obstacles can be overcome. Therapists like Dr. Sarah Anderson suggest that couples work on building emotional intelligence, learning to recognize and regulate their emotions, and developing effective communication skills. By addressing these barriers head-on, couples can create a more supportive and understanding environment, fostering deeper emotional intimacy.

The Science of Sensuality: Understanding the Body’s Response

To navigate the sensual realm effectively, it is essential to understand the body’s intricate response to pleasure. Dr. Lewis explains, “Our bodies are equipped with an array of sensory receptors that, when stimulated, trigger a cascade of physiological responses. From increased heart rate and heightened awareness to the release of pleasure-inducing hormones, the body’s reaction to sensual experiences is a complex and beautiful symphony.”

By familiarizing themselves with their own bodies and their partner's, individuals can learn to recognize and respond to these physiological cues. This awareness allows for a more intentional and fulfilling sensual journey, as couples can navigate their shared experiences with greater sensitivity and understanding.

Sensory StimulationResponse
TouchSkin-to-skin contact triggers the release of oxytocin, known as the 'love hormone', promoting bonding and intimacy.
SightVisual stimulation can enhance arousal and excitement, as the brain processes and interprets visual cues.
TasteSensual tastes, such as chocolate or strawberry, can stimulate the senses and enhance the overall experience.
SoundSoothing or erotic sounds can create an ambiance that heightens arousal and deepens the connection.
SmellScents, like pheromones, can trigger physiological responses, impacting mood and desire.

The Psychology of Seduction: Understanding the Science of Attraction

At the core of seduction lies a deep understanding of human psychology and the intricate dynamics of attraction. According to renowned relationship psychologist Dr. Sophia Taylor, “Seduction is not merely about physical appearance or sexual prowess; it is a complex interplay of emotions, body language, and subtle cues that create an irresistible allure.”

Dr. Taylor explains that seduction is a multi-faceted process, involving several key elements. Firstly, it begins with self-confidence and a positive self-image. When individuals feel secure in their own skin, they exude an aura of attraction that is hard to resist. Additionally, non-verbal communication plays a crucial role, with body language, eye contact, and facial expressions conveying interest and desire.

Furthermore, seduction involves creating an atmosphere of intrigue and anticipation. By introducing elements of surprise, novelty, and playful flirtation, partners can keep the spark alive, maintaining a sense of excitement and curiosity within the relationship. As Dr. Taylor emphasizes, "Seduction is an art that requires intention, creativity, and a deep understanding of your partner's desires."

Seduction TechniquesDescription
Eye ContactIntense and prolonged eye contact can convey interest and desire, creating an intense connection.
Body LanguageUsing open and inviting body language, such as relaxed postures and subtle touches, can signal availability and attraction.
Teasing and FlirtationPlayful banter, subtle innuendos, and light-hearted teasing can create a fun and seductive atmosphere.
Sensual TouchGentle caresses, strokes, and intimate gestures can convey affection and desire, deepening the connection.
Verbal AffirmationsCompliments, affirmations, and suggestive language can boost self-esteem and intensify the allure.

The Impact of Communication on Intimate Relationships

Communication impacts intimate relationships in profound ways. Firstly, it allows couples to express their needs and desires openly, creating an environment where both partners feel heard and understood. This fosters a sense of security and intimacy, as individuals can be their authentic selves without fear of judgment or rejection.

Furthermore, effective communication enables partners to navigate conflicts and disagreements with grace and maturity. By expressing their concerns and listening actively to their partner's perspective, couples can find mutually beneficial solutions, strengthening their bond and fostering a deeper level of respect.

Additionally, communication plays a vital role in enhancing sexual intimacy. By discussing their sexual desires, boundaries, and preferences, couples can create a safe and supportive space for exploration and experimentation. This open dialogue allows them to connect on a deeper level, fostering a more satisfying and fulfilling sexual relationship.
